eSportWS


Click here for a complete list of operations.

Spows_insertProspect

Select all fields from Individuals or Institutions
Parameters list:
ALIASCustomer identificationStringMandatory
LANGCulture name used for translated field namesStringOptional
HELPFlag to return help node with output structure, field type and translated field namesBool(0/1 or True/False)Optional
LIGHTWEIGHTFlag to return data fields in attributes instead of nodesBool(0/1 or True/False)Optional
CEN_IDCenter IDStringOptional
PRP_CONSULTORConsultor IDUniqueidentifierMandatory
PRP_NOMEProspect NameStringMandatory
PRP_SEXOProspect GenderString (M/F)Mandatory
PRP_DTNASCProspect Birth DateDateTimeOptional
PRP_EMAILProspect emailStringMandatory if phone and NIF are empty
PRP_TELEMOVEL1Prospect PhoneStringMandatory if email and NIF are empty
PRP_PAISCountry IDStringMandatory if email and phone are empty
PRP_NCONTProspect NIFStringMandatory if email and phone are empty
PRP_TELEMOVEL2Prospect MobileStringOptional
PRP_FORMAENTRADAProspect OriginIntMandatory
PRP_PROMOCAOAssociated PromotionGuidOptional
PRP_REDESOCIALSocial NetworkString ('Facebook','Twitter','LinkedIn','GooglePlus','YouTube','Orkut','Hi5','Tuenti','Flickr','MySpace','Badoo','Bebo')Optional
PRP_REFINDPROProposerGuidOptional
PRP_REFENTPROProtocol entityGuidOptional
PRP_ENTIDADEProtocol entity nameStringOptional
PRP_ENTNIFProtocol entity NIFStringOptional
PRP_PRATDESPPractices sport?Bool(0/1 or True/False)Optional
PRP_PRATDESPTEMPOIf not, how long?Int (5=Less than 6 months,10=Less than a year,15=Over a year)Optional
PRP_PRATDESPFORMAIf yes, which sportStringOptional
PRP_DISCDISCStringOptional ('Directivo','Interactivo','Sereno','Cauteloso')
PRP_DORIDObjectiveIntMandatory
PRP_ESTADOProspect stateInt (0=Closed,1=Cold,2=Warm,3=Hot,9=Converted)Mandatory
PRP_MARCAPROXIMOSchedule next contact?Bool(0/1 or True/False)Mandatory
PRP_FORMACOMUNICACAONext contact methodString ('eMail','Telefone','Pessoal','SMS','Carta','Facebook','Sitio')Mandatory if PRP_MARCAPROXIMO = 1
PRP_PROXIMOCONTACTONext contact dateDateTimeMandatory if PRP_MARCAPROXIMO = 1
PRP_NOTASObservationsStringOptional
CONSENTSConsents list nodeMandatory
  CONSENTConsent nodeMandatory
    ICONS_IDConsent IDIntMandatory
    ICONS_VALUEConsent valueBool(0/1 or True/False)Mandatory

Test

The test form is only available for requests from the local machine.

SOAP 1.1

The following is a sample SOAP 1.1 request and response. The placeholders shown need to be replaced with actual values.

POST /Demo/ES/WebServices/eSportWebServices.asmx HTTP/1.1
Host: 62.28.251.246
Content-Type: text/xml; charset=utf-8
Content-Length: length
SOAPAction: "https://www.esport.pt/webservices/Spows_insertProspect"

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<Spows_insertProspect xmlns="https://www.esport.pt/webservices/">
      <oParam>string</oParam>
    </Spows_insertProspect>
  </soap:Body>
</soap:Envelope>
HTTP/1.1 200 OK
Content-Type: text/x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
  <soap:Body>
    <Spows_insertProspectResponse xmlns="https://www.esport.pt/webservices/">
      <Spows_insertProspectResult>string</Spows_insertProspectResult>
    </Spows_insertProspectResponse>
  </soap:Body>
</soap:Envelope>

SOAP 1.2

The following is a sample SOAP 1.2 request and response. The placeholders shown need to be replaced with actual values.

POST /Demo/ES/WebServices/eSportWebServices.asmx HTTP/1.1
Host: 62.28.251.246
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<Spows_insertProspect xmlns="https://www.esport.pt/webservices/">
      <oParam>string</oParam>
    </Spows_insertProspect>
  </soap12:Body>
</soap12:Envelope>
HTTP/1.1 200 OK
Content-Type: application/soap+xml; charset=utf-8
Content-Length: length

<?xml version="1.0" encoding="utf-8"?>
<soap12: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ap12="http://www.w3.org/2003/05/soap-envelope">
  <soap12:Body>
    <Spows_insertProspectResponse xmlns="https://www.esport.pt/webservices/">
      <Spows_insertProspectResult>string</Spows_insertProspectResult>
    </Spows_insertProspectResponse>
  </soap12:Body>
</soap12:Envelope>